UP Board 10th 12th Result 2026: The wait for the UP Board Class 10 and 12 Results 2026 is almost over. There are strong signs that the results will be announced between April 23 and April 25. The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ad ran the tests from February 18 to March 12. The grading is now done.

There hasn’t been an official confirmation yet, but students and parents all over Uttar Pradesh are keeping a close eye on the final announcement.

Date of Expected Results and Official Websites

UP Board 10th 12th Result 2026: Once they are announced, you can find the results on official websites like: upresults.nic.in upmsp.edu.in

How to Find Out Your UP Board 10th 12th Result 2026

The process is still easy and friendly for students:

  • Go to the website for official results
  • Click on the link for the Class 10 or Class 12 results.
  • Type in your roll number and hit “submit.”
  • Check out and download the provisional marksheet

Students should know that schools will send out the original marksheets in 4 to 6 weeks.

What Parents Do: Support Over Stress

This is a very important time for parents to guide their children, not compare them. Having open talks about strengths, interests, and realistic goals can make a big difference.

It’s also important to look into scholarships like INSPIRE for students with high test scores and keep track of when applications are due. There are many ways to succeed with skill-based learning and other options, even if the results aren’t perfect.
